Output 43cfa912516d38540cc8079fbe82aaa9faf05b0204e7547119aeb50b23387fee:1

value
34425215
script pubkey
OP_0 OP_PUSHBYTES_20 d1ab704c1934b5d7c223fec3b6a2cadf7c2db7ad
address
ltc1q6x4hqnqexj6a0s3rlmpmdgk2ma7zmdady3cf9m
transaction
43cfa912516d38540cc8079fbe82aaa9faf05b0204e7547119aeb50b23387fee
spent
true